Shane Lowry blamed an ESPN reporter for involvement with a decision at a critical moment in the PGA 2025 championship.

Getty Images

Friday’s second round at 2025 PGA Championship It was a painful for Shane Lowry. The former open champion lost cutting from one, in no small part thanks to a terrible rest that led to destructive destruction.

That bad break also inspired a Explosions of the club gathered and the Furious Club by pro veteran. But after his round, Lowry revealed that the intervention of a reporter on the ESPN course during this critical moment had contributed to his furious reaction.

To set the scene, Lowry was playing the 8th hole in The empty quil During the second round of Friday. Despite a rotating round that presented other disappointments and “mud balls”, Lowry found himself right in the cut line in one over.

Better still, he had a short par-4, before him. Lowry stripped his car on the right track, but when he reached his ball he found him lying at the bottom of a deep divin.

Knowing that you get relief only if your ball comes to rest in your tar of the pitch, Lowry however called in a rules official to be safe.

His next kick from Divot went Haywire, ending up in a bunker, and Lowry had it. He shouted “F – this place!” and slammed his club into offensive divas. Eventually, he cheated the hole and ended up in two to lose the cut.

Lowry Blasts’ TV reporter intervention

After the round, Lowry explained a critical detail that lost in the midst of this subsequent moment at 8. According to Lowry, a TV reporter ESPN tried to interfere with the Divot decision after he told a media scrum on Friday, As reported by Irish.

“I was just asking the judge, and the ESPN guy comes directly and he is like,” That’s not your tar of the pitch. “And I’m like,” That’s not for you to talk about me. “It is for me to call an official rule and decide what happens. Said Lowry.

He went on: “It was just that the ESPN boy was a bit involved there when he was not asked to be and that is what bothers me a lot.”

Lowry also argued that he was not trying to break the rules and get a free fall when he didn’t deserve one, he just wanted to be sure with “so much in the discussion”.

“I don’t want a drop because it’s not my tar of the tar. But I’m just saying. And it turns to (the fact that) I had a lot of mud balls again today.”

You can read Lowry’s full comments in Irish here.

While Lowry lost the cut in this PGA championship, he admitted that Quail Hollow was “one of the only places in which I have never played well”. But he has played well so far this season.

In 12 Starters, Lowry already has Two racing conclusions among four top-10sincluding last week’s Truist Championship.

The best news for Lowry? Only when his game is being rounded up in shape, the open championship is going back to Royal Portrush, the place of his open championship victory, in two months.
